How Stress and anxiety Escalates Without Therapy

Anxiousness Issues have a particularly insidious method of developing more powerful after a while when still left untreated. What starts as occasional fret or nervousness can progressively increase to encompass a lot more scenarios, ideas, and experiences. This phenomenon, referred to as generalization, occurs in the event the Mind learns to associate nervousness with the increasingly wide choice of triggers.

One example is, someone that in the beginning activities stress about public Talking may possibly locate their fears expanding to incorporate any social predicament, then Skilled meetings, and inevitably any interaction with unfamiliar individuals. The avoidance behaviors that naturally acquire as coping mechanisms truly reinforce the anxiousness, developing a cycle in which each prevented scenario confirms into the brain which the concern was justified.

Physical signs or symptoms also have a tendency to accentuate with time. What starts off as occasional butterflies inside the tummy can progress to stress attacks, Continual muscle mass tension, insomnia, and digestive challenges. The continuous condition of hypervigilance exhausts the anxious system, leading to tiredness and rendering it even more challenging to cope with everyday stressors.

The Progressive Character of Untreated Despair

Despair follows a similarly regarding trajectory when still left devoid of Experienced intervention. In contrast to short term unhappiness, scientific despair will involve persistent modifications in brain perform that influence temper, Electricity, slumber, hunger, and cognitive abilities. With out remedy, these adjustments may become far more entrenched, generating Restoration progressively hard.

One of the more perilous components of untreated despair is the way it distorts contemplating designs. Adverse ideas grow to be a lot more frequent and intense, developing a psychological filter that screens out beneficial activities and focuses exclusively on issues and failures. This cognitive distortion reinforces feelings of hopelessness and worthlessness, rendering it just about extremely hard for individuals to determine potential methods or good reasons for optimism.

The behavioral alterations connected with depression also compound eventually. Social withdrawal, minimized action ranges, and neglect of self-treatment generate extra problems that gas the depressive cycle. Relationships put up with, operate efficiency declines, and physical wellbeing deteriorates, offering more "evidence" to support the depressive way of thinking.

The Neuroscience Powering Worsening Symptoms

Exploration in neuroscience has exposed why stress and anxiety and depression usually worsen without having procedure. Equally conditions entail changes in neural pathways and brain chemistry that come to be much more recognized as time passes by way of a system referred to as neuroplasticity. Effectively, the brain gets significantly effective at making nervous or depressive responses, creating these designs additional computerized and tougher to interrupt.

Continual worry related to untreated mental overall health disorders also leads to elevated cortisol amounts, which often can destruction Mind structures involved in memory, Understanding, and psychological regulation. This Organic impression clarifies why those with long-standing anxiousness or depression usually report sensation like their indicators became aspect in their identification rather then a treatable ailment.
